The Pharmacy Project Manager for the Medical Kit Team oversees the end-to-end production of home and travel medical kits for members. Working within a pharmacy environment, this role is responsible for managing the production of approximately 500 kits per month, each containing around 35 prescriptions. The ideal candidate is an organized, detail oriented operations leader who can balance regulatory compliance, team performance, and production efficiency in a pharmacy setting. Core Responsibilities
Manage the monthly production of ~500 home and travel medical kits, each containing approximately 35 prescriptions Develop, document, and continuously improve standard operating procedures (SOPs) for kit assembly and quality control Monitor production workflows to ensure kits are assembled accurately, on schedule, and in compliance with pharmacy regulations. Oversee inventory management of prescription medications, OTC items, and packaging materials Coordinate with pharmacists and pharmacy technicians to ensure accurate prescription fulfillment within each kit
Supervise, mentor, and evaluate production team staff including pharmacy technicians and kit assembly personnel Manage scheduling, workload distribution, and staffing needs to meet monthly production targets Conduct onboarding and ongoing training for new team members Foster a culture of accuracy, accountability, and member-first quality
Maintain accurate records for prescription dispensing, lot tracking, and expiration date management Conduct quality control checks and audits; investigate and resolve errors or member complaints Manage recalls, drug shortages, or formulary changes affecting kit contents
Track and report on key performance indicators (KPIs) such as kit accuracy rates, production throughput, and cost per kit Provide regular updates to pharmacy leadership on production status, risks, and improvement initiatives Collaborate with clinical and member services teams to anticipate changes in kit requirements or member needs Lead capacity planning efforts to scale production as membership grows
Work Environment
On-site pharmacy production environment; regular presence on the production floor required Collaborative team of pharmacists, pharmacy technicians, and kit assembly staff Fast-paced, quality-driven setting with monthly production cycles and ongoing process improvement
